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Age 18-75 years 2. Gender both male and female 3. Patients with stroke chronicity 3-120 months (The groups in 3month-2 years and 2-10 years will be evaluated post-hoc separately) 4. No previous clinical stroke 5. Single-lesioned, Ischemic / Hemorrhagic Cortical/Sub-cortical stroke type 6. Patient conscious, coherent, comprehendible, cooperative 7. Patient having upper-limb paresis 8.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E) score 24-30. 9. MRC power 1-3 10. Modified Ashworth Scale 1, 1+, 2, 3 11. Brunnstrom Stage 3-5 12. EMG activity of EDC muscle present (even if it is a flicker) 13. Surgical intervention to correct hand deformities e.g., tendon transfers with power quantified through surface EMG
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Having progressive neurological disorders 2. Cognitively declining (MMSE 16)
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| 1. Spasticity is measured using the Modified Ashworth Scale (MAS) at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 2. Motor functionality is measured using Fugl-Meyer Assessment (FMA), Active and Passive Range of Motion (AROM and PROM), Motor Assessment Scale at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 3. Stage of recovery using Bruunstrom Stage (BS) at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 4. Activities of Daily Living (ADL) participation using Modified Barthel Index (MBI) at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 5. Disability level by Modified Rankin Scale (MRS) at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 6. Hand laterality measured by Edinburg scale of laterality index at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 7. Muscle power using Muscle Research Council (MRC) scale at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| 1. TMS Cortical excitability measures i.e., Resting Motor Threshold (RMT), Motor Evoked Potential (MEP), latency at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year 2. Functional Neuroimaging (fMRI & DTI) Measures at baseline, 4 weeks, 3 months, 6 months and 1 year. 3. Task-performance measures using time taken to complete, smoothness of trajectory, relative error at baseline and 4 weeks 4. Subjective questionnaire feedback after completion of therapy | — |
